It cost more. Here's how it works. As a native speaker, it takes 20 min for me to write 500 word articles the way 90% of the writers write (in terms of research and I dont write that often). For a dude from developing country it takes perhaps 1 hour. The lowest is around $3.5. He can work 8 hours a day and make at least 30 dollars. He can work 5 times a week and make around 600 dollars, which is a descent salary for them in India/Philippines and other places.

That's why it is hard to get native writer for cheap. Most of them are in developed countries and they can't and won't work for 600-1000 dollars.

If you say so... the point is, your money goes longer in the developing nations or 3rd world as some like to call it.

The reason why Nike's shoes are of decent quality is because they've got millions of dollars to invest to train people, to create systems, to ensure quality control and other things that all add up.

You can hire well educated people from developing nations with a bachelor's degree or a master's degree that would be able to provide you with quality services and you'd still only be paying a fraction of what it would cost to hire someone like that in the US/UK/CA etc. If you want to ensure you get consistent high quality stuff, then you need to put up systems in place.

I know 1 person on here that is in a developing nation but he delivers better content to me than the content I would have gotten paying working with someone from the first world .... because he's got systems and great talent. The price is around $40 - I would have to fork over $100-200 per article for the same calibre content if I were to higher someone from the US.
